Sustainable Innovation in Production and Events with Megan Best, Native Events and Alex De Valera, Ecoscope
Two incredible entrepreneurs breaking new ground in this space, Megan Best and Alex De Valera join us in studio to discuss how their work is making Production (Action Two) and Events (Action Four) more sustainable. Megan is CEO of Native Events and Co-founder and Director, Julie’s Bicycle Europe. Alex De Valera is a Director at Ecoscope Ltd. advising on sustainability production for TV, Film and commercial. They share the challenges they have to face in a fast paced industry and lay out the best way to get value from your sustainability advisors. They have examples of inspiration from the worlds of European festivals and Irish film productions. Diageo’s Rachel Maher and Jamie Fulham talk operations, media and changing behaviour
Two powerhouses, Rachel Maher (Society and Sustainability Manager) and Jamie Fulham (Planning and Media Manager) from Diageo tell us about how their business is working towards Net Zero. We are focused on learning how they are doing Operations (Action One), Media (Action Three), and harnessing consumer behaviour (Action Five) to get to Net Zero. We learn about the ‘Spirit of Progress’ Agenda which directs their big ambitions and state of the art actions as they decarbonise their business. We also hear about how they are approaching creative work and media decisions that need to consider customers in so many different countries. Sustainability is a principle and a driver of innovation in Diageo, and they are working to inspire people and other organisations on their journey too. Ad Net Zero Ireland 101 with Mary O’Sullivan
Mary O’Sullivan, Director of International Markets, Ad Net Zero, tells us how Ad Net Zero started and how it is going. She speaks about the resources available, the ways organisations can get involved and get value. It is an inspiring discussion about a movement that is growing quickly providing case studies, training, inspiration and networking within the industry. The door is always open, no matter how big or small your organisation is; support is here. This episode gives a great grounding and answers a lot of questions people have at the beginning of their journey and touches on all five of the ANZ Actions.
